Hi Harry,
I had a rough time trying to figure what would end up being the best framing for this pic. I tried opening up the right side... so the bird was peering into the shot... but it just didn't "feel" right. Go figure...:dunno
The lighting wasn't actually great that day. The sun was still high in the afternoon sky... so I metered off a bright space of the image and knocked the exposure down by 1/3 to create the illusion that the sun was low in the sky!
